Venster Techniek is an experienced manufacturer of sills for both wooden and plastic window frames. The high-quality sills for wooden window frames meet the highest requirements of the Building Code and are extensively tested for wind and water tightness. "In order to achieve a high-quality and reliable result, all products are manufactured and fully assembled in-house in detail and to size," says Herben Heino.

"For example, we prepare locking pots in the desired location so that the processor only has to assemble them. This results in greater convenience and significantly faster assembly."

Ultimate customization

The sills for plastic frames, developed for several leading profile manufacturers, also offer the ultimate in customization. Not only are they manufactured in close coordination with the customer, the burglar-resistant and extensively tested products are also characterized by outstanding wind and water tightness. 

"One of our specialties is EEAL, the fiberglass-reinforced lower sill system," explains Heino. "Like the other profile variants, it meets the required maximum step height as prescribed in the Building Code. New to this sill is a double frame seal, also for double doors. A specific connection piece has been developed for the center connection of the double doors so that the seal fits neatly there."

Official launch

At Polyclose, the European trade fair for window, door, shading, façade and access technology, Venster Techniek recently presented a brand new product with the VTD sills. That official introduction will be repeated in stand 6201 during HoutPro+ 2022, which will take place from November 1 to 4 at the Brabanthallen in 's-Hertogenbosch. 

"The VTD involves an expansion of the existing EEFD and EEFD+-program and will eventually replace it," said Heino. "Whereas the current sill program for wooden frames is made of aluminum and a combination of fiberglass and aluminum, respectively, the new VTD is a sill composed entirely of fiberglass." 

Available in the versions Prestige (for the entire sill) and Excellent (hybrid version), Venster Techniek thus not only offers a more sustainable solution, this sill type also stands for significantly higher insulation values.

Fewer hoods, more opportunities

Where the VTD does not differ from the existing EEFD and EEFD in terms of dimensions and method of processing+-under sills, the launch of the new product is accompanied by two welcome product modifications. For example, the neutral of each VTD sill is finished in anthracite, a shade that provides more unity and style all around the profile fabrication. Furthermore, the introduction of the VTD is accompanied by the arrival of a number of other hood variants. 

"In the case of the existing systems, we have a matching hood for each rebate variation," Heino continues. "That is not the case with this new system. For the VTD, we offer a select number of caps that allow more rebate variants. They are smart additions that can be quickly and easily positioned on any sill. In short: with fewer different materials, you can generate more solutions."
